LOL, she is buying some new clothes, but she knows I always buy a gun this time of year for my "birthday" in june, lol.
This will be my first revolver. I was looking at the judge for a long time and honestly the only thing that swayed me away from the judge was the price of 45LC. When I discovered you can shoot ACP with the gov and saw that the fit and finish was far superior to the judge, along with the extra chamber, i was sold. Yes the price is a lot more, but its an investment and a gun I will really enjoy.
I plan to keep it loaded with Hornady critical defense 410 and 45LC hollow points alternating for home defense. When going to the range ill use 45ACP and 410.
I also ordered a cool moon clip loader, that way im not bending my moon clips.

May I suggest:
Moon clips for Governor,Moon Clips for S&W Governor
Polymer moon clips for the range. SOOOO much easier to deal with. Probably not a good idea for nightstand use, as the clip is pretty flexible. If dropped or handled "roughly" the rounds will pop out (at least for me, despite the video on the website).
